External plugin authors occasionally need emergency access to the Gridsmith puzzle-compilation service when the standard plugin token exchange fails. Break-glass access bypasses the normal review queue, so use it only when a published crossword pack is actively broken for solvers. Every use is logged and reviewed by the Gridsmith platform team within one business day. Open the recovery console, select your plugin namespace, and confirm the incident reference. When prompted, enter the recovery passphrase shown below.

strongbox words: norwyn-wenael-aldvan-aldiel-wendor-holael

# Lanternreef Environments: Timezone Handling in Report Exports

Report exports in Lanternreef always render timestamps in the tenant's configured zone, not the server zone. Staging defaults differ from production, which has bitten release managers before. Before cutting a release, verify both environments agree. The current production export settings are listed below.

service settings:
PRAWYN_PIN=9848
PRAWYN_METRICS_HOST=metrics.prawyn.lumicworks.corp
PRAWYN_LOG_LEVEL=warn
PRAWYN_TENANT=pelius

## Session Handling for Health Checks

The Corvel gateway sits behind the Lanternside load balancer, which probes /healthz every ten seconds. Health-check requests are stateless by design: they bypass the session store entirely so that probe traffic never inflates session counts or evicts real user sessions. New team members should note that the deep-check endpoint, /healthz/deep, does verify session-store connectivity and therefore requires authentication. When probing it manually, supply the token below.

bearer token for tajep-kajef: eyJhbGciOiJIUzI1NiIsInR5cCI6IkpXVCJ9.eyJzdWIiOiIoOsZ23In0.CsygO0hs